The Sands Hotel and Casino
The Sands Hotel and Casino was arguably the epicenter of the Rat Pack's Las Vegas reign. Sinatra's legendary performances at the Copa Room are etched into the Sands' history, drawing countless fans to witness his unmatched talent. The Sands, with its glamorous ambiance and high-stakes games, perfectly encapsulated the era. The Cal Neva Lodge and Casino
Located on the shores of Lake Tahoe, the Cal Neva Lodge and Casino holds a special place in Rat Pack history, particularly due to its strong association with Frank Sinatra. This historic casino, with its stunning lakefront location, offered a more relaxed atmosphere compared to the bustling casinos of the Las Vegas Strip.
